dailyloe.com – Cleveland personal injury lawyer Tim Misny will star in a documentary film about his life and career later this year. The film titled ‘The Misny Movie’ follows his rise to local fame through unconventional advertising. His billboards featuring the phrase ‘I’ll make them pay’ have become regional icons.
Misny has built a recognizable brand through creative marketing campaigns across Northeast Ohio. His image has appeared on merchandise including T-shirts and holiday items. He has also been photoshopped into various humorous scenarios on his advertisements.
‘It’s a serious business,’ Tim Misny stated regarding his legal practice. ‘But nowhere does it say you can’t have fun with your advertising.’ The lawyer emphasized his enjoyment in engaging with the local community through his distinctive promotional style.
Alongside the documentary, an artificially generated video series called ‘The Adventures of Tim Misny’ has been released. This series presents a surreal, fictionalized version of the attorney’s life. Both projects expand his presence beyond traditional advertising mediums.
‘Northeast Ohio is phenomenal,’ Misny said, ‘and I’m having a lot of fun with it.’ The documentary represents another personal stamp on the region he calls home. The film is scheduled to arrive for public viewing later in 2026.
Tim Misny’s law practice focuses on personal injury cases where he represents plaintiffs. His advertising slogan promises aggressive representation for clients seeking compensation. The upcoming documentary will explore both his professional work and local cultural impact.[]
